Late last year, Brooklyn outfit KNTRLR dropped their latest video, for the song ‘Stabs’. The video was released ahead of the band’s debut full-length album, set to drop on Goodnight Records.

Around town, KNTRLR is known for their blown-out synths and intricate layering. This video couples their musical perspective with a dynamic and visually stunning piece. It features an onslaught of images, with singer Michael Henry’s face superimposed on top of everything from a filleted heart to stock footage of some lighthearted executions. These particular visuals double as excellent background footage for what has come to be known as an excellent stage show.

KNTRLR is made up of a duo of

Brooklyn based musicians who were members of a number of innovative acts around the borough. According to its Facebook page, the group’s members met at a Russian bathhouse back in 2008.  Since then, they’ve become known for amazing live shows, where they create an impressive wall of sound for a duo, one that blows out speakers and keeps the crowd dancing and sweaty for the duration of their high-energy sets.

The first single from the new album is for a jaunty track called ‘CAA’, which inspired this deliriously energetic video.  Their debut album is out this spring, so make sure you check back and snag a copy from Goodnight Records so that you can be the cool kid on the block who spins it first.
